Our impact, in numbers

Locally led, community measured — what your support makes possible.

1,800+
Families reached
Across Migori & Homa Bay since 2023
320+
Workshops held
For teachers, clinicians & community
12 / mo
Support groups
Safe spaces for sharing & guidance
3
Counties active
Migori, Homa Bay, Kisumu — growing
